summ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--dev-db/pgeasy/ChangeLog10
-rw-r--r--dev-db/pgeasy/files/Makefile-gentoo.patch9
-rw-r--r--dev-db/pgeasy/files/digest-pgeasy-3.0.11
-rw-r--r--dev-db/pgeasy/pgeasy-3.0.1.ebuild35
4 files changed, 55 insertions, 0 deletions
diff --git a/dev-db/pgeasy/ChangeLog b/dev-db/pgeasy/ChangeLog
new file mode 100644
index 000000000000..c0f5e5d65d05
--- /dev/null
+++ b/dev-db/pgeasy/ChangeLog
@@ -0,0 +1,10 @@
+# ChangeLog for dev-db/pgeasy
+# Copyright 2000-2003 Gentoo Technologies, Inc.;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/dev-db/pgeasy/ChangeLog,v 1.1 2003/04/04 19:51:27 mkennedy Exp $
+
+*pgeas-3.0.1 (04 Apr 2003)
+
+ 04 Apr 2003; Matthew Kennedy <mkennedy@gentoo.org> ChangeLog,
+ pgeasy-3.0.1.ebuild, files/digest-pgeasy-3.0.1 :
+
+ Initial import.
diff --git a/dev-db/pgeasy/files/Makefile-gentoo.patch b/dev-db/pgeasy/files/Makefile-gentoo.patch
new file mode 100644
index 000000000000..39e54c465a5a
--- /dev/null
+++ b/dev-db/pgeasy/files/Makefile-gentoo.patch
@@ -0,0 +1,9 @@
+--- Makefile.orig 2003-04-04 13:23:27.000000000 -0600
++++ Makefile 2003-04-04 13:25:14.000000000 -0600
+@@ -33,5 +33,5 @@
+ install:
+ install $(soname) $(POSTGRES_HOME)/lib
+ rm -f $(POSTGRES_HOME)/lib/$(TARGET).so
+- ln -s $(POSTGRES_HOME)/lib/$(soname) $(POSTGRES_HOME)/lib/$(TARGET).so
+ install -c $(TARGET).h $(POSTGRES_HOME)/include
++ cd ${POSTGRES_HOME}/lib && ln -s $(soname) $(TARGET).so
diff --git a/dev-db/pgeasy/files/digest-pgeasy-3.0.1 b/dev-db/pgeasy/files/digest-pgeasy-3.0.1
new file mode 100644
index 000000000000..4ebabc75bbc3
--- /dev/null
+++ b/dev-db/pgeasy/files/digest-pgeasy-3.0.1
@@ -0,0 +1 @@
+MD5 6a50fac1231aad1a32215664ca186552 pgeasy-3.0.1.tar.gz 6977
diff --git a/dev-db/pgeasy/pgeasy-3.0.1.ebuild b/dev-db/pgeasy/pgeasy-3.0.1.ebuild
new file mode 100644
index 000000000000..8bbf518e8be4
--- /dev/null
+++ b/dev-db/pgeasy/pgeasy-3.0.1.ebuild
@@ -0,0 +1,35 @@
+# Copyright 1999-2003 Gentoo Technologies, Inc.
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/dev-db/pgeasy/pgeasy-3.0.1.ebuild,v 1.1 2003/04/04 19:51:27 mkennedy Exp $
+
+DESCRIPTION="An easy-to-use C interface to PostgreSQL."
+HOMEPAGE="http://gborg.postgresql.org/project/pgeasy/projdisplay.php"
+SRC_URI="ftp://gborg.postgresql.org/pub/pgeasy/stable/${P}.tar.gz"
+LICENSE="BSD"
+SLOT="0"
+KEYWORDS="~x86"
+IUSE=""
+
+DEPEND=">=dev-db/postgresql-7.3.2"
+
+S=${WORKDIR}/${P}
+
+src_unpack() {
+ unpack ${A}
+ cd ${S} && patch -p0 <${FILESDIR}/Makefile-gentoo.patch || die
+}
+
+src_compile() {
+ make POSTGRES_HOME=/usr CFLAGS="${CFLAGS}" || die
+}
+
+src_install() {
+ dodir /usr/lib
+ dodir /usr/include
+ make POSTGRES_HOME=${D}/usr install || die
+ dodoc CHANGES README
+ dohtml docs/*.html
+ cp -r examples ${D}/usr/share/doc/${P}/
+}
+
+# Notes: pgeasy won't build static libraries